Rhode Island – Patrick Lynch Lobbied Rhode Island Attorney General’s Office for Years but Never RegisteredThe Daily Journal – Michelle Smith (Associated Press) | Published: 11/17/2014 Since his tenure as Rhode Island’s attorney general ended, Patrick Lynch has lobbied his former office several times, but he has never registered with the state as a lobbyist.
